Lot Number: 147

Description: LeBron James game worn basketball sneakers with Tribute Inscription to President Obama. Blue and white leather Nike LeBron James professional model sneakers were worn by James in a game played on January 23, 2009 against the Golden State Warriors. James scored 30 points in the victory including a buzzer beating 19 foot jump shot to win the game for the Cavaliers. "It's a great feeling, especially when you get it like that and then you hear the horn and the shot goes in and there's no way they can try to make a comeback at us,' James said. "I wish everyone could get that type of feeling. It's unbelievable.' The sneakers have been signed by James in silver sharpie on a side panel. On the front portion of each shoe, James wrote a tribute inscription to President Obama, who had just recently been inaugurated into office on January 20th, 2009. The black sharpie inscriptions reads, "44th President Barack Obama". LeBron James was a devoted supporter of the President during his campaign for office. Absolutely unique pair of LeBron James game worn sneakers with relation to the historic inauguration of President Obama. Includes COA from Upper Deck Authenticated: EX-MT
